Emmerdale confirms Dawn’s jealousy as Billy moves on
Emmerdale is turning up the heat in the Dales next week as Dawn Fletcher finds herself battling unexpected emotions. Although she ended her relationship with Billy to be with Joe Tate, the sight of her ex moving on with Gabby Thomas has stirred a storm of jealousy, leaving viewers questioning whether Dawn truly wants Billy back.
Dawn’s Green-Eyed Dilemma

The village spy reveals that Dawn is visibly unsettled as she observes Billy’s blossoming romance with Gabby. “Billy deserves some happiness after what Dawn did,” our source explains. “His relationship with Gabby Thomas is developing nicely, despite a few teething problems. But it seems Dawn is struggling—if she can’t have Billy, she doesn’t want anyone else to!”
Dawn attempts to assert control over the situation by asking Gabby to delay telling Clemmie and Lucas about the new relationship. Her rationale is to protect the children from any potential upset, but her interference only fuels tension. Gabby bristles at being dictated to by her boyfriend’s ex, and her resentment adds another layer of complexity to the unfolding drama.
Innocent Eyes and Uneasy Conversations
Inevitably, the secret is revealed when Clemmie spots Billy and Gabby sharing a kiss. Her curiosity forces Dawn to acknowledge the truth, confirming that Billy and Gabby are indeed an item. While Clemmie reacts with a cheerful acceptance, happy that Billy has found someone new, Dawn’s pain is palpable. The actress portrays a woman torn between lingering affection and the reality of her past decisions, creating a poignant exploration of heartbreak and envy.
Gabby’s Own Struggles
As if Dawn’s interference weren’t enough, Gabby faces her own personal battles. The source highlights that Gabby’s ongoing food anxiety is intensifying, impacting her day-to-day life and threatening her budding relationship. “She even bans Thomas from attending a kid’s birthday party after seeing the menu,” the insider notes. “With Dawn adding pressure, Gabby is fighting multiple insecurities, and viewers will be on the edge of their seats to see if she can navigate this without it affecting her romance with Billy.”
Exploring Obsessive Behaviour
Emmerdale’s producer, Laura Shaw, has confirmed that the show is deliberately using Gabby’s storyline to explore the dark side of obsessive healthy eating. “It’s going to be a big story for Gabby,” Shaw says. “She lost Vinny and, being pushed away by Ross, begins to focus more intensely on controlling what she eats. Initially, it seems harmless, but we’ll see how obsession can spiral out of control.”
This nuanced depiction gives viewers insight into mental health challenges, particularly how anxiety and past trauma can resurface under stress, affecting relationships and daily life.
